Avatar f tn It can also be malaria which is often difficult to catch by diagnostic tests. In a country like India, often treatment is started if malaria is suspected. UTI is another common cause. Pneumonia and ear infections are probably ruled out as you have no related symptoms that you report. If nothing is caught, then it could be viral or even typhoid. A comprehensive investigation is required keeping all the points in mind. Talk to your treating doctor. Take care!

Avatar f tn There can be honest disagreement among experts about the management of RML atelectasis, bronchiectasis and recurrent pneumonia, despite appropriate, intense medical treatment, in young children with a normal immune system. There is general agreement, however that, when localized bronchiectasis, especially of the RML, becomes refractory, more severe or resistant to medical management, lobar resection may be warranted.

Avatar n tn A patented product in India and South Africa, patents for Nudoxa have also been filed in EU, US, Japan and several countries globally. Doxorubicin, the first generation drug, was launched in 1960s and gave a new lease of life to cancer patients with its ability to combat aggressive and malignant tumours. This DNA-interacting drug, however, was discovered to cause life-threatening side effects in the form of cardiac abnormalities.
